This page documents environment variables for Mergewren, our customer-record deduplication service. DEDUP_THRESHOLD controls fuzzy-match sensitivity (0.0–1.0; default 0.85). DEDUP_BATCH_SIZE caps records per merge pass. DEDUP_DRY_RUN, when true, logs proposed merges without writing. All merge decisions are audit-logged and reversible for 30 days. The service signs its audit entries with a credential that must appear in the env file on the line immediately following this note.

sealed setting: ARCHIVE_KEY3=8d0

Handover note — Crumbwheel order cutoffs.

Welcome aboard. The bakery cutoff rule in Crumbwheel closes same-day orders at 14:00 local to each storefront, not UTC — this has bitten us twice. Holiday overrides live in the calendar service and take precedence silently, so always check there first when a cutoff looks wrong. To unlock the calendar service's admin console after a restart, enter the recovery passphrase below.

vault phrase of bagap-bahaf = silion-pelox-sorox-casdor-quenwyn-fraax-eliox-praael-kelion-quenvan-kasox-rusael-norius-belvan

Runbook 14-C: Recall Returns. The pallet of recalled VoltBee chargers from the Harrowfield depot is shrink-wrapped, tagged, and staged at Bay 6. Records team logs the manifest count before release; do not break the wrap. Fenwick Logistics collects Tuesday mornings only. The driver will ask for the release code at hand-over, so note the following instruction.

handover note for yagef-bagep: the drudor pelius courier leaves the kasdor zorvan norir ledger at gate 8016 under passcode 755406

## Deployment — TokenMend Hotfix Service

This release addresses the session-token refresh bug where tokens expiring during an in-flight refresh were silently invalidated, logging users out mid-request. The fix introduces a grace window and single-flight refresh locking. Deploy to the canary pool first and watch refresh-failure metrics for thirty minutes before promoting. Reviewers should confirm the grace window does not exceed the token TTL. The deployed service reads the following configuration at startup.

config for kagup-hahig:
druwyn:
  pin: 2801
  metrics_host: metrics.druwyn.zemvarlabs.internal
  tenant: sorius
  seal: seal_798a43d7